(Vladimir_Timofeev/iStock) Quantum computers perform calculations based on the probability of an object's state before it is measured - instead …Quantum key distribution (QKD) is a secure communication method for exchanging encryption keys only known between shared parties. It uses properties found in quantum physics to exchange cryptographic keys in such a way that is provable and guarantees security. QKD enables two parties to produce and share a key that is used to encrypt and ...

For regular computers, bits are the basic unit of information. They are binary, that is, they …The RZ gate implements exp (-i\frac {\theta} {2}Z) exp(−i2θZ). On the Bloch sphere, this gate corresponds to rotating the qubit state around the z axis by the given angle. n n is the number of qubits needed to support the gate. Quantum photonics is the science and technology which uses quantum optics for certain applications where quantum effects play an essential role. It is an area within photonics, and the term is more frequently applied in the context of technology, i.e., applications, than in fundamental science.. Applications of Quantum Photonics.
